Overview
- A suspect shot a Kentucky State Police trooper on Terminal Drive at Blue Grass Airport, then carjacked a vehicle to continue the attack.
- At Richmond Road Baptist Church the gunman opened fire, killing parishioners Beverly Gumm, 72, and Christina Combs, 32, and injuring two men.
- State troopers and Lexington police officers confronted the attacker minutes later and fatally shot him, with three officers firing under department policy.
- The trooper and wounded church victims were transported to nearby hospitals, with the trooper in stable condition and one man critical.
- Kentucky State Police, Lexington PD, the ATF and FBI are examining body-worn camera footage and forensic evidence as investigators seek a motive.
